Why my start page says "you are not on the latest version of Firefox. Update today to get the best of the Web! "when in fact I have the latest version?
I've upgraded to the latest version of Firefox, but I always get a message on my home page that says "you are not on the latest version of Firefox. Update today to get the best of the Web! »
You can see this message under the Google search box on www.google.com/firefox which is the old default Firefox homepage. It seems that this page is no longer maintained by Google. You seem to have the latest version of Firefox.
If you want as the Google search page as homepage, change your homepage to Subject: House (a new version of the old homepage Google/Firefox update is now integrated into Firefox).

Actually, it says it's 'you are not on the latest version of Firefox. Update today to get the best of the Web! ", but I use the latest version of Firefox, FireFox 9.0, so there is nothing to be upgraded to! So, why my browser seems determined to force an upgrade on me I already have?
Do you not see that the message on the site www.google.com/firefox
The site www.google.com/firefox has been used in versions of Firefox 3.
The current versions of Firefox 4 + is no longer use this website from Google as home page, but use the build-in on: home page as the home page.
Google is no longer seems to keep this page and assumed that you are using an older version of Firefox, if you visit again you and this site warns that you are using an older version of Firefox and invites you to update.
You can ignore this message if you are running the latest version of Firefox, as shown in the window "help > About" (Firefox is updated).
You can use a different page than the homepage as subject: House or www.google.com or www.google.com/ig (iGoogle). -

Why the NDP module says "you are not allowed for this operation?"
Hello world
I hope you can help me with this problem!
I'm playing with the NDP module has a message saying 'you are not allowed for this operation.
This happens when I try to create a new project and try to open the window to select a project type. It also happens when I go to the ADMIN and add new types of projects?
Is there a role limiting me or does some other underlying problem?
Thank you in advance.
Hello
I think that you might miss an active project type category.
Go to Admin-> NDP-> categories of project types.
You must have at least one category that is active (which is indicated by a green check mark).
Once at least one is activated, you will need to go to the Cache and rinse the taxonomy of cache (just to be sure, I would empty Admin Data Cache Group as well).
Then you can go to the Admin and configure your project types.

You are not on the latest version of Firefox. Update today to get the best of the Web!
Whenever I update my firefox, I get this message, you are not on the latest version of Firefox. Update today to get the best of the Web!
It - http://www.google.com/firefox - is the old Page to start Firefox used by the Firefox 3.6 and earlier versions of Firefox. I think that Google assumes that you are using an older version of Firefox, as they hard-coded message 'upgrade' in this page - all versions of Firefox see this message.
From version Firefox 4, Firefox uses a 'local' with the address Start Page of Subject: House. It looks like the old start Page, but this isn't exactly the same thing.
